Blogi z podróży - Your blog in Polish

Rozpocznij blog z podróży

I can hardly keep up with all the new languages we're launching the blogs in at the moment - but that's a good thing of course :) As of this week it's possible to set your blog to Polish! Of course you can write your blog in any language you please, but if you have a lot of readers from Poland who don't understand 'Subscribe' means, then I recommend you change it to 'Zaprenumeruj' by setting your blogs language to Polish. You can set the language for your blog in the settings part of your travel blog management area. The instructions in last weeks entry should help if you are unsure. The only difference should be that you need to select Polish from the drop down list instead of 'German' :)

Your travel blog in German

Another language added!

First off, Happy New Year! Join in the forum thread and wish your fellow TP members the same :)

Other than that, just a quick little post to inform all of you of the addition of German to the travel blog area. For all of you keeping blogs in German this means that all the English labels around your blog can now be set to German which is pretty nice (at least we think so!). Just to be clear, you can, as always, write your actual blog posts in any language you can think of. This just applies to all the default labels and text around the blog.

To make this change, visit your 'my blogs' page and click on the Settings link for the blog you want to change. One of the settings (the 4th one down) is to set the Locale (Language) and German is now included in that list. After setting it to German, watch your 'Latest Entries' magically be transformed to 'Letzte Einträge', amongst many others of course.
